掌握远程Linux密钥管理:安全高效访问服务器策略
远程linux密钥

首页 2024-12-03 00:22:42



远程Linux密钥管理:安全高效运维的基石 在当今的数字化时代,Linux操作系统凭借其强大的稳定性、灵活性和开源特性,成为了服务器领域的首选平台

    随着云计算和分布式系统的普及,越来越多的企业和开发者需要在远程环境中管理和维护Linux服务器

    然而,远程管理带来的便捷性同时也伴随着安全风险的增加,尤其是当涉及到密钥管理时

    本文旨在深入探讨远程Linux密钥管理的重要性、面临的挑战、最佳实践以及如何利用现代技术工具来构建安全高效的运维体系

     一、远程Linux密钥管理的重要性 远程Linux密钥管理,简而言之,是指对用于远程访问、身份验证、数据加密等功能的密钥进行安全存储、分发、更新和撤销的过程

    这些密钥包括但不限于SSH密钥对、SSL/TLS证书、数据库密码、API密钥等

    它们构成了服务器安全的第一道防线,直接关系到系统的完整性和数据的保密性

     1.增强安全性:通过集中管理和严格控制密钥的生命周期,可以有效防止未经授权的访问和数据泄露

    例如,强密码策略、定期更换密钥、密钥轮换机制等都能显著提升系统安全性

     2.提升效率:自动化密钥管理减少了手动配置密钥的繁琐过程,降低了人为错误的风险,使运维团队能够更专注于核心业务

     3.合规性:许多行业和地区对数据保护和隐私有严格的法律法规要求

    良好的密钥管理实践是满足这些合规要求的关键

     二、面临的挑战 尽管远程Linux密钥管理至关重要,但在实际操作中,企业和运维团队面临着诸多挑战: 1.密钥分散与失控:随着服务器数量的增加,密钥往往分散在多个位置,难以统一管理和监控,增加了泄露风险

     2.权限管理复杂:不同用户和服务需要不同的访问权限,如何精确控制密钥的访问权限而不影响业务运行是一大难题

     3.密钥生命周期管理:密钥的创建、分发、使用、更新和撤销需要严格的流程管理,任何环节的疏漏都可能造成安全隐患

     4.集成与兼容性:现有的IT环境中可能包含多种操作系统、应用程序和云服务,如何实现密钥管理系统的无缝集成是一大挑战

     5.成本与资源:实施高效的密钥管理解决方案往往需要投入大量资金和技术资源,对于中小企业而言尤为困难

     三、最佳实践 为了克服上述挑战,构建安全高效的远程Linux密钥管理体系,以下是一些被广泛认可的最佳实践: 1.采用集中化密钥管理解决方案:

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道